    Counts per minute (abbreviated to cpm) is a measure of the detection rate of ionization events per minute. Counts are only manifested in the reading of the measuring instrument, and are not an absolute measure of the strength of the source of radiation.     The world record in the mile run is the fastest time set by a runner in the middle-distance track and field event. World Athletics is the official body which oversees the records. Hicham El Guerrouj is the current men's record holder with his time of 3:43.13, [ 1] while Faith Kipyegon has the women's record of 4:07.64. [ 2]

    This is a list of world records in Olympic weightlifting. These records are maintained in each weight classfor the snatchlift, clean and jerklift, and the total for both lifts. The International Weightlifting Federation(IWF) restructured its weight classes in 1993, 1998 and 2018, nullifying earlier records. Current records.
